There are regulations attached to the cross-border shipping of batteries to ensure they travel safely. These regulations vary depending on the type of batteries.
If you’re handling international battery shipping, it’s vital to navigate the complex, strict guidelines enforced by bodies like the International Air Transport Association (IATA) and the United Nations (UN). Battery shipping, especially concerning lithium-ion batteries, is heavily regulated due to its hazardous nature.
Most people relocating overseas can avoid all issues by simply not taking these batteries with them and buying new ones upon arrival. However, this easy way out is not afforded to those who want to transport the second main type of battery, a lithium-ion battery.
Similar guidelines apply no matter whether you’re shipping batteries within Europe or Worldwide. The following regulations apply when you are relocating possessions, including batteries, in a shipping container. This also includes a shared shipping container – often referred to as groupage.
As lithium batteries are classified as hazardous or dangerous goods and have been known to cause fires on both ships and aeroplanes, many shipping services (including PSS International) are no longer able to ship them. However, some courier companies are willing to accept as long as you follow strict guidelines.
